Adjust Your Picture Settings for Optimal SDR Performance

Start by accessing your TV’s picture menu and switching to the professional or custom preset. Avoid automatic or vivid modes, which often oversaturate HDR content but underperform in SDR.

Disable Auto Brightness and Dimming Features

Turn off auto-dim, auto-brightness, and power-saving modes. These features can cause the panel to underperform in dark scenes, making blacks appear gray and reducing contrast—an issue common with 2026 PHOLEDs.

Fine-Tune Your Brightness and Contrast

Set the contrast to around 80-90% depending on room lighting. Adjust brightness to match ambient light levels, aiming for a level where black areas are truly black without crushing detail. This balances the panel’s native capabilities and prevents dim SDR image output.

Calibrate Color Settings

Set color temperature to ‘Warm’ or ‘Expert’ mode to maneuver around over-saturation tendencies. Reduce saturation levels slightly if colors look overly intense, helping make SDR content look more natural and less washed-out.

Reduce Black Crush and Improve Shadow Detail

Increase black level slightly—if your TV allows—to prevent losing shadow details in dark scenes. Use a test pattern to find the sweet spot where black looks deep but retains detail.

Adjust Gamma for Better Brightness Gradients

Set gamma to 2.2 or 2.4—depending on your preference—to optimize mid-tone brightness. Proper gamma ensures that shades and shadows render correctly, improving the overall SDR picture quality.

When it comes to choosing the perfect home theater TV or gaming OLED, many enthusiasts fall into common misconceptions that can seriously hamper their viewing experience. One widespread myth is that all OLED panels perform equally across different genres and lighting conditions. In reality, aggressive marketing often oversimplifies what these displays can deliver, leaving consumers surprised when their new best OLED models struggle with shadow detail or color accuracy in dark environments.

Another trap to avoid is believing that higher peak brightness automatically equates to better picture quality. While HDR content dazzles with vibrant highlights, an overemphasis on brightness can cause unbalanced images, especially if your TV isn’t properly calibrated. Industry experts, like those from advanced display research, warn that mastering a display’s contrast management and color fidelity is crucial, beyond just looking at spec sheets.

Advanced users should be cautious of the ‘myth’ that firmware updates fix all picture quality issues. Firmware can improve certain functions, but many nuances—such as black crush or HDR tone mapping—require careful calibration and sometimes hardware adjustments. It’s essential to recognize that some issues underlying the performance of HDR TVs are intrinsic to panel design or component quality. Therefore, relying solely on updates without proper calibration might leave your display underperforming.

Keep Your OLED at Its Best with a Calibration Routine

Establishing a calibration routine isn’t complicated but makes a marked difference in long-term picture quality. I recommend testing your display with controlled test patterns available from sources like industry experts and adjusting your settings periodically, especially if you notice color shifts or black crush issues. Regular calibration can prevent image degradation caused by aging components and ensure your HDR content continues to shine brightly.

Tools I Recommend for Ongoing Maintenance

Beyond calibration hardware, I suggest keeping a clean, dust-free environment to minimize particles settling on your screen or inside vents, which can affect cooling. For cleaning, use a microfiber cloth and avoid harsh chemicals that can damage the OLED’s delicate layer. If you’re serious about image fidelity, a SPT-1000 Photometer can help measure brightness and ensure your display’s luminance stays within optimal ranges without risking burn-in.
